Burial Beer Co. Raids the Candy Jar to Create Skillet Snacks

Burial Beer Co. (Asheville, North Carolina) has officially announced that it will begin the Limited Release of Skillet Snacks on Wednesday, May 26.

Concocted to be an even more decadent take on Burial’s infamous Skillet Donut Stout “made from a blend of nine barley malts, a healthy scoop of oats, milk and molasses sugars, and [their] favorite blend of freshly roasted Counter Culture Coffee beans,” Skillet Snacks takes the OG Skillet and “[ages it] upon heaps of house-made peanut butter, French Broad Chocolates Cocoa Nibs, fresh vanilla bean, and some candy sugars.” Coming in at 8% ABV, Skillet Snacks offers a “fistful of molten reeces cups chased with bags of M&M’s and washed down with caramel hot chocolate.”

A very limited amount of 4-packs of 16 oz. cans of Skillet Snacks – along with cans of the original Skillet and the Skillet mug pictured above – will be available for online presale for pickup at Burial Beer Co.’s Asheville taproomRaleigh taproom and Charlotte taproom at noon on May 26. If any cans survive the presale, the brewery will release those in their online shop for nationwide shipping on May 27 at noon. Skillet Snacks will not see distribution. Prost!

Vital Information for Skillet Snacks from Burial Beer Co.

Release – Limited; May 26, 2021
Style – Milk Stout
ABV – 8%
Featured Ingredients – Peanut butter, French Broad Chocolate cocoa nibs, vanilla bean & candy sugars
Availability – 4-packs of 16 oz. cans ($22 per 4-pack)
Distribution – None. Brewery & online store only
